Kirsten Camp has been named First Team Google Cloud Academic All District IV.
The 2018-19 Google Cloud Academic All-District® Women's Track/Cross Country Team, selected by CoSIDA, recognizes the nation's top student-athletes for their combined performances in the athletic realm and in the classroom. The Google Cloud Academic All-America® program separately recognizes outstanding student-athletes in four divisions — NCAA Division I, NCAA Division II, NCAA Division III and NAIA.
First-team Academic All-District® honorees advance to the Google Cloud Academic All-America® ballot. First-, second- and third-team (if applicable) Academic All-America® honorees will be announced in June.
Camp, a senior Exercise Science major from Attica, Ohio, was one of only five athletes on the list with a GPA of 3.90 or higher. She was the only G-MAC women's track and field athlete on the list.
Camp was also previously selected as a USTFCCCA All Midwest Region pick in the heptathlon, in which she finished second at the G-MAC Outdoor Championships. She was also the G-MAC Indoor Champion in the pentathlon. She was twice named G-MAC Field Athlete of the Week this season.
